您当前的位置:首页 > 百宝箱

易语言矩形数据如何赋值

2024-09-30 21:08:03 作者:石家庄人才网

石家庄人才网今天给大家分享《易语言矩形数据如何赋值》,石家庄人才网小编对内容进行了深度展开编辑,希望通过本文能为您带来解惑。

在易语言中,矩形数据通常使用 RECT 结构体来表示。RECT 结构体包含四个成员,分别表示矩形的左上角和右下角的坐标。要对矩形数据进行赋值,可以使用以下方法:

1. 直接赋值:

可以使用点号运算符 (.) 直接访问 RECT 结构体的成员,并为其赋值。例如,以下代码将创建一个矩形,其左上角坐标为 (10, 20),右下角坐标为 (50, 60):

```易语言.版本 2.数据类型 RECT 左上角_x 为 整数型 左上角_y 为 整数型 右下角_x 为 整数型 右下角_y 为 整数型.数据结束.子程序 _按钮1_被单击 局部变量 矩形数据 为 RECT 矩形数据.左上角_x = 10 矩形数据.左上角_y = 20 矩形数据.右下角_x = 50 矩形数据.右下角_y = 60 // 使用矩形数据进行其他操作 .子程序_结束```

2. 使用 API 函数:

易语言提供了一些 API 函数,可以方便地创建和操作矩形数据。例如,可以使用 `SetRect()` 函数设置 RECT 结构体的值,使用 `OffsetRect()` 函数移动矩形的位置,使用 `InflateRect()` 函数缩放矩形的大小等。石家庄人才网小编提示,以下代码演示了如何使用 `SetRect()` 函数创建矩形:

```易语言.版本 2.子程序 _按钮1_被单击 局部变量 矩形数据 为 RECT SetRect (矩形数据, 10, 20, 50, 60) // 使用矩形数据进行其他操作 .子程序_结束```

3. 从其他数据类型转换:

如果需要从其他数据类型(例如字符串或数组)创建矩形数据,可以使用易语言提供的类型转换函数。例如,可以使用 `到整数()` 函数将字符串转换为整数,然后将整数赋值给 RECT 结构体的成员。

在实际开发中,可以根据具体的需求选择合适的赋值方法。建议尽量使用 API 函数来操作矩形数据,因为 API 函数通常比直接访问结构体成员效率更高,代码也更易读。

石家庄人才网小编对《易语言矩形数据如何赋值》内容分享到这里,如果有相关疑问请在本站留言。

版权声明:《易语言矩形数据如何赋值》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/5658.html